33问答网
所有问题
定时器/计数器定时50ms 100ms,晶振为12MHz,分别应选择哪种工作方式?初值应设置为多少(十六进制)?
如题所述
举报该问题
其他回答
第1个回答 2012-05-27
T0 方式1
50ms:
TH0 = 0x3C;
TL0 = 0x0B0;
100ms超出定时范围了。可以用两次50ms代替。本回答被提问者采纳
相似回答
用
定时
/
计数器
T1产生定时时钟,P1口控制8个发光二极管使8个灯依次闪烁...
答:
用定时/
计数器
T1
定时50ms,晶振
频率取
12MHz,定时器初值
为3CB0H,采用中断方式,用变量计数中断次数。P1口控制8个发光二极管LED灯,每50ms中断,控制一个灯亮/灭一次,中断两次为
100ms,
闪一次,一秒钟闪10次,闪烁频率为10。仿真图如下图所示。
...
50ms,晶振为12MHz,分别应选择哪种工作方式
,
初值应?
答:
工作方式需要选择 "工作方式1"
,也就是 "模式1",即设置 TMOD 的低四位为 0001 。因此,对于这两种定时器/计数器,都应该选择 "工作方式1" ,并设置相应的初值。具体而言,对于10ms定时应设置TH0为0xd8,TL0为0xf0;对于50ms定时应设置TH0为0xc2,TL0为0x38。
定时器
T1
工作方式
有哪几
种?
答:
一、使用方式一:晶振频率
为12MHz,
机器周期为1us
,50ms
时间需要计数50000次,故
计数器初值
为(65536-50000),65536是因为方式一中
,定时
/计数器的最大值为65536(2^16),当然写程序时不一定非要这么计算,因为定时/计数器是溢出产生中断,也就是从最大加1就溢出,最大加1就是等于0的,只要计数个...
大家正在搜
定时器计数器工作方式0为
定时器计数器工作方式1是
8253作为定时器和计数器时
定时器0方式1定时50ms
定时器和计数器的工作原理
定时器0的工作方式
定时器工作方式1是
定时器计数器的编程和应用
8253定时器计数器实验
相关问题
设振荡频率为12MHz,如果用定时/计数器T0产生周期为10...
单片机编程 设单片机的晶振频率为12MHZ,请编出利用定时/...
单片机的晶振频率为6MHz,定时50ms,则初值怎么设置,应...
设MCS-51单片机使用的晶振是12MHz,欲使用定时器/计...
简单的单片机问题
单片机:若系统晶振频率是12MHZ,利用定时器/计数器1定时...
定时器T0如用于下列定时,晶振频率为12MHz,试为定时器T...
若要求定时器T0工作于方式1,定时时间为10ms ,晶振为1...